What is Secondary Glazing?


Secondary glazing involves the installation of a discrete, independent internal window frame behind an existing primary window. Unlike double glazing, which changes the existing window unit, secondary glazing permits the initial external windows to remain undamaged. This is especially crucial for noted buildings or residential or commercial properties found in conservation areas where preparing permissions strictly forbid changes to the exterior facade.

While the concept might appear straightforward, the execution requires a high level of technical accuracy. Professionals in this field need to account for numerous aspects, consisting of frame alignment, air space optimization, and specialized glass types to accomplish particular performance goals.

Why Experience Matters: The Professional Approach


When engaging with experienced secondary glazing professionals, a number of critical technical components are managed that amateur installers might ignore.

1. Accuracy Measurement and Structural Irregularities

Older homes are rarely completely “square.” Frames may be warped, and walls may have settled over decades or centuries. Experienced specialists utilize advanced measuring tools to produce bespoke design templates. A space of even a few millimeters can lead to acoustic “leak,” rendering the soundproofing benefits of the secondary glazing practically ineffective.

2. Optimizing the Cavity

The distance between the primary window and the secondary pane— referred to as the cavity— is the most considerable aspect in efficiency. For thermal insulation, a smaller gap is frequently adequate. Nevertheless, for maximum sound reduction, a broader space (usually in between 100mm and 200mm) is required. Specialists determine this ideal distance based upon the particular needs of the building.

Thermal Efficiency and Energy Savings

By developing an additional barrier, secondary glazing removes drafts and substantially minimizes the U-value (heat loss rate) of a window. Experienced specialists use high-quality seals that develop an airtight environment, which can minimize heat loss through windows by more than 60%.

Acoustic Insulation

For homes found near busy roads, airports, or railway lines, sound pollution is a significant concern. Professionals understand the science of noise. By utilizing various densities of glass for the main and secondary panes (called asymmetrical glazing), they can prevent supportive resonance, efficiently “eliminating” the noise as it goes through the window.

Condensation Mitigation

Condensation is a common by-product of single-pane windows in cold climates. Professionals ensure that the secondary system is installed with manageable ventilation or moisture-absorbent products between the panes, avoiding the growth of mold and securing the wood of the original window frames.

The Installation Process: What to Expect


An expert setup follows a structured workflow created to reduce disturbance:

  1. Initial Consultation: A site see to assess the primary windows and understand the client's objectives (noise vs. heat).
  2. Technical Survey: Precise measurements are taken, frequently using laser technology, to account for any frame variances.
  3. Bespoke Fabrication: The systems are made in a regulated factory setting.
  4. Site Preparation: The location is safeguarded, and main windows are cleaned completely.
  5. Precision Fitting: The frames are fixed, and specialized border seals are applied.
  6. Quality control: A last test of all moving parts and a demonstration of how to operate and clean up the systems.

Regularly Asked Questions


Is secondary glazing better than double glazing for soundproofing?

Yes. Due to the fact that secondary glazing permits a much bigger air space (as much as 200mm) compared to the small gap in a double-glazed unit (16mm-20mm), it is considerably more efficient at obstructing low-frequency noises like traffic and aircraft sound.

Do I need planning approval?

In the vast majority of cases, no. Given that secondary glazing is an internal modification and does not alter the external appearance of the residential or commercial property, it is generally exempt from planning permission, even in noted structures. Can secondary glazing be removed?

Yes. One of the primary advantages of expert secondary glazing is that it is a reversible alteration. This makes it a perfect option for tenants or for heritage homes where permanent changes are restricted.

For how long does the setup take?

For a standard domestic home, experts can usually complete the setup in one or 2 days, depending upon the number of windows and the intricacy of the frames.
